Remember that that camera makes and uses a small JPEG to display on the screen, whereas when you are looking on your computer you're looking either at the RAW file or a large JPEG depending on your settings. In any case, most shots will look sharp on a tiny 3" screen unless they are quite badly OOF.
If on your computer you are looking at the 100% view ( in DPP terms ) then most images will not look sharp - try using 50% view to get a better feel. Also, what happens if you apply some sharpening to your images - do they look good then ?
